Kleinjung T, Peter N, Schecklmann M, Langguth B. The Current State of Tinnitus Diagnosis and Treatment: a Multidisciplinary Expert Perspective. J Assoc Res Otolaryngol 2024:10.1007/s10162-024-00960-3. [PMID: 39138756 DOI: 10.1007/s10162-024-00960-3]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/28/2023] [Accepted: 07/31/2024] [Indexed: 08/15/2024] Open
Abstract
Tinnitus, the perception of sound without an external source, affects 15% of the population, with 2.4% experiencing significant distress. In this review, we summarize the current state of knowledge about tinnitus management with a particular focus on the translation into clinical practice. In the first section, we analyze shortcomings, knowledge gaps, and challenges in the field of tinnitus research. Then, we highlight the relevance of the diagnostic process to account for tinnitus heterogeneity and to identify all relevant aspects of the tinnitus in an individual patient, such as etiological aspects, pathophysiological mechanisms, factors that contribute most to suffering, and comorbidities. In the next section, we review available treatment options, including counselling, cognitive-behavioral therapy (CBT), hearing aids and cochlear implants for patients with a relevant hearing loss, sound generators, novel auditory stimulation approaches, tinnitus retraining therapy (TRT), pharmacological treatment, neurofeedback, brain stimulation, bimodal stimulation, Internet- and app-based digital approaches, and alternative treatment approaches. The evidence for the effectiveness of the various treatment interventions varies considerably. We also discuss differences in current respective guideline recommendations and close with a discussion of how current pathophysiological knowledge, latest scientific evidence, and patient perspectives can be translated in patient-centered care.

Succop B, Thompson NJ, Dedmon MM, Gelinne A, Selleck A, Reed S, Sindelar MBD. Noninvasive Treatment of Venous Pulsatile Tinnitus with an Internal Jugular Vein Compression Collar. Laryngoscope 2024; 134:3342-3348. [PMID: 38345081 DOI: 10.1002/lary.31326]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/24/2023] [Revised: 12/11/2023] [Accepted: 01/17/2024] [Indexed: 06/18/2024]
Abstract
OBJECTIVE The study was conducted to evaluate the safety and efficacy of mild internal jugular (IJV) compression via an FDA approved compression collar for symptomatic treatment of venous pulsatile tinnitus. METHODS This is a prospective study that recruited 20 adult patients with venous pulsatile tinnitus. Participants completed the Tinnitus Handicap Inventory (THI), were fitted with the collar, and rated symptom intensity on a 10-point tinnitus intensity scale before and during collar use. Once weekly for 4 weeks, they answered a survey quantifying days used, average tinnitus intensity before and after wearing the collar each day of use, and any safety concerns. Lastly, they completed an exit interview. The primary outcome was symptomatic relief, with secondary outcomes of safety, effect of treatment setting, effect of time, and quality of life assessed via nonparametric testing. RESULTS 18 participants completed the study, and 276 paired daily before use/during use intensity scores were submitted. The median symptom intensity without the collar was 6 (IQR 4, 7), whereas with the collar it was 3 (IQR 2, 5), for a median symptomatic relief of 50%. The collar had a significant effect in reducing symptom intensity (p < 0.0001) and burden of illness via the THI (p < 0.0001). There was no effect of setting, frequency, or time on symptomatic relief with the collar. There were no adverse safety events reported aside from minor discomfort upon initial application. CONCLUSIONS Venous compression collars offer acute symptom relief for patients with venous pulsatile tinnitus. Further study is needed to assess safety and efficacy of longitudinal use. Wong SH, Pontillo G, Kanber B, Prados F, Wingrove J, Yiannakas M, Davagnanam I, Gandini Wheeler-Kingshott CAM, Toosy AT. Visual Snow Syndrome Improves With Modulation of Resting-State Functional MRI Connectivity After Mindfulness-Based Cognitive Therapy: An Open-Label Feasibility Study. J Neuroophthalmol 2024; 44:112-118. [PMID: 37967050 PMCID: PMC10855987 DOI: 10.1097/wno.0000000000002013] [Citation(s) in RCA: 2]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2023]
Abstract
BACKGROUND Visual snow syndrome (VSS) is associated with functional connectivity (FC) dysregulation of visual networks (VNs). We hypothesized that mindfulness-based cognitive therapy, customized for visual symptoms (MBCT-vision), can treat VSS and modulate dysfunctional VNs. METHODS An open-label feasibility study for an 8-week MBCT-vision treatment program was conducted. Primary (symptom severity; impact on daily life) and secondary (WHO-5; CORE-10) outcomes at Week 9 and Week 20 were compared with baseline. Secondary MRI outcomes in a subcohort compared resting-state functional and diffusion MRI between baseline and Week 20. RESULTS Twenty-one participants (14 male participants, median 30 years, range 22-56 years) recruited from January 2020 to October 2021. Two (9.5%) dropped out. Self-rated symptom severity (0-10) improved: baseline (median [interquartile range (IQR)] 7 [6-8]) vs Week 9 (5.5 [3-7], P = 0.015) and Week 20 (4 [3-6], P < 0.001), respectively. Self-rated impact of symptoms on daily life (0-10) improved: baseline (6 [5-8]) vs Week 9 (4 [2-5], P = 0.003) and Week 20 (2 [1-3], P < 0.001), respectively. WHO-5 Wellbeing (0-100) improved: baseline (median [IQR] 52 [36-56]) vs Week 9 (median 64 [47-80], P = 0.001) and Week 20 (68 [48-76], P < 0.001), respectively. CORE-10 Distress (0-40) improved: baseline (15 [12-20]) vs Week 9 (12.5 [11-16.5], P = 0.003) and Week 20 (11 [10-14], P = 0.003), respectively. Within-subject fMRI analysis found reductions between baseline and Week 20, within VN-related FC in the i) left lateral occipital cortex (size = 82 mL, familywise error [FWE]-corrected P value = 0.006) and ii) left cerebellar lobules VIIb/VIII (size = 65 mL, FWE-corrected P value = 0.02), and increases within VN-related FC in the precuneus/posterior cingulate cortex (size = 69 mL, cluster-level FWE-corrected P value = 0.02). CONCLUSIONS MBCT-vision was a feasible treatment for VSS, improved symptoms and modulated FC of VNs. Rodriguez CR, Piccirillo JF, Rodebaugh TL. Acceptability of Cognitive Behavioral Therapy for Tinnitus: A Study With Veterans and Nonveterans. Am J Audiol 2023; 32:593-603. [PMID: 37566882 PMCID: PMC10558150 DOI: 10.1044/2023_aja-23-00020]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/01/2023] [Revised: 04/18/2023] [Accepted: 05/25/2023] [Indexed: 08/13/2023] Open
Abstract
PURPOSE Cognitive behavioral therapy (CBT) is a gold standard yet underutilized treatment for tinnitus, and tinnitus is especially highly prevalent among veterans. The aims of this study were twofold: to determine (a) if CBT for tinnitus is underutilized because participants find it less acceptable than other behavioral treatments for tinnitus and (b) if veterans and nonveterans rate behavioral treatments for tinnitus differently. METHOD This cross-sectional study was conducted online with a sample of 277 adults in the United States who self-reported at least some level of bothersome tinnitus in the past week. The sample for this study consisted of 129 veterans and 148 nonveterans. Participants read descriptions of CBT, tinnitus retraining therapy (TRT), and mindfulness-based stress reduction (MBSR). For each treatment, presented to them in random order, they provided credibility, expectancy, and acceptability ratings. RESULTS Among 277 participants, 147 (53.07%) reporting gender were women, 216 (77.98%) reporting race/ethnicity were White, and 129 (46.57%) were veterans of any branch of the U.S. Armed Forces. Veteran ratings of credibility, expectancy, and acceptability were significantly lower than nonveteran ratings across treatments. There were differences in credibility, expectancy, and acceptability ratings across treatments, and post hoc testing revealed that TRT was consistently rated higher than CBT or MBSR. CONCLUSIONS Despite strong research support, CBT was rated as less acceptable than a different, less widely empirically supported treatment. Veterans' ratings of acceptability were lower than those of nonveterans across all treatments.

Langguth B, Kleinjung T, Schlee W, Vanneste S, De Ridder D. Tinnitus Guidelines and Their Evidence Base. J Clin Med 2023; 12:jcm12093087. [PMID: 37176527 PMCID: PMC10178961 DOI: 10.3390/jcm12093087] [Citation(s) in RCA: 7] [Impact Index Per Article: 7.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/17/2023] [Revised: 04/17/2023] [Accepted: 04/22/2023] [Indexed: 05/15/2023] Open
Abstract
Evidence-based medicine (EBM) is generally accepted as the gold standard for high-quality medicine and, thus, for managing patients with tinnitus. EBM integrates the best available scientific information with clinical experience and patient values to guide decision-making about clinical management. To help health care providers and clinicians, the available evidence is commonly translated into medical or clinical guidelines based on a consensus. These involve a systematic review of the literature and meta-analytic aggregation of research findings followed by the formulation of clinical recommendations. However, this approach also has limitations, which include a lack of consideration of individual patient characteristics, the susceptibility of guideline recommendations to material and immaterial conflicts of interest of guideline authors and long latencies till new knowledge is implemented in guidelines. A further important aspect in interpreting the existing literature is that the absence of evidence is not evidence of absence. These circumstances could result in the decoupling of recommendations and their supporting evidence, which becomes evident when guidelines from different countries differ in their recommendations. This opinion paper will discuss how these weaknesses can be addressed in tinnitus.

Wang B, Gould RL, Kumar P, Pikett L, Thompson B, Gonzalez SC, Bamiou DE. A Systematic Review and Meta-Analysis Exploring Effects of Third-Wave Psychological Therapies on Hearing-Related Distress, Depression, Anxiety, and Quality of Life in People With Audiological Problems. Am J Audiol 2022; 31:487-512. [PMID: 35549513 DOI: 10.1044/2022_aja-21-00162]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/09/2022] Open
Abstract
PURPOSE There is growing evidence supporting the use of third-wave psychological therapies, such as mindfulness-based interventions (MBIs) and acceptance and commitment therapy (ACT), for people with long-term or chronic physical health conditions. We conducted a systematic review and meta-analysis to critically evaluate the effectiveness of third-wave interventions for improving hearing-related distress and psychological well-being in people with audiological problems. METHOD We searched online bibliographic databases and assessed study quality. We conducted random-effects meta-analyses if at least two randomized controlled trials (RCTs) examined hearing-related distress, depression, anxiety, or quality of life in people with audiological problems. Findings of pre-post studies were summarized narratively. RESULTS We identified 15 studies: six RCTs and nine pre-post studies. The methodological quality of studies was mostly poor to moderate, and sample sizes were typically small (overall n = 750). Most studies focused on tinnitus (n = 12), MBIs (n = 8), and ACT (n = 6). Statistically significant improvements in hearing-related distress were found with ACT and MBIs versus controls and other treatments at post-intervention in people with tinnitus, while improvements in depression and anxiety were only found for ACT versus controls at post-intervention. However, gains were either not maintained or not examined at follow-up, and there was no evidence for improvements in quality of life. CONCLUSIONS At present, there is insufficient evidence to recommend the use of third-wave interventions for improving hearing-related distress or psychological well-being in people with audiological problems. There is some evidence that ACT and MBIs may be useful in addressing hearing-related distress in people with tinnitus, but only in the short term. However, findings should be interpreted with caution given the small number of studies with generally small sample sizes and mostly poor-to-moderate methodological quality. More high-quality, adequately powered, double-blind RCTs, particularly in audiological problems other than tinnitus, are needed to draw firm conclusions and meaningful clinical recommendations. Oosterloo BC, de Feijter M, Croll PH, Baatenburg de Jong RJ, Luik AI, Goedegebure A. Cross-sectional and Longitudinal Associations Between Tinnitus and Mental Health in a Population-Based Sample of Middle-aged and Elderly Persons. JAMA Otolaryngol Head Neck Surg 2021; 147:708-716. [PMID: 34110355 DOI: 10.1001/jamaoto.2021.1049] [Citation(s) in RCA: 13]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/20/2022]
Abstract
Importance Tinnitus is a common disorder, but its impact on daily life varies widely in population-based samples. It is unclear whether this interference in daily life is associated with mental health problems that are commonly detected in clinical populations. Objective To investigate the association of tinnitus and its interference in daily life with symptoms of depression and anxiety and poor sleep quality in a population-based sample of middle-aged and elderly persons in a cross-sectional analysis and during a 4-year follow-up. Design, Setting, and Participants This cohort study evaluated data from the population-based Rotterdam Study of individuals 40 years or older living in Rotterdam, the Netherlands. Between 2011 and 2016, data on tinnitus were obtained during a home interview at least once for 6128 participants. Participants with information on depressive and anxiety symptoms and self-rated sleep quality, with Mini-Mental State Examination scores indicating unimpaired cognition, and with repeatedly obtained tinnitus and mental health outcome data were included. Data analyses were conducted between September 2019 and April 2020. Main Outcomes and Measures The presence of tinnitus and its interference with daily life were assessed during a home interview. Depressive symptoms were assessed with the Center for Epidemiologic Studies-Depression, anxiety symptoms with the Hospital Anxiety and Depression Scale, and sleep quality with the Pittsburgh Sleep Quality Index. Linear regression analyses and linear mixed models adjusted for relevant confounders were used to assess the cross-sectional and longitudinal association of tinnitus with mental health. Results Of 5418 complete-case participants (mean [SD] age, 69.0 [9.8] years; 3131 [57.8%] women), 975 (mean [SD] age, 71.7 [4.5] years; 519 [53.2%] women) had repeated measurements available for follow-up analyses. Compared with participants without tinnitus and participants with nonbothersome tinnitus, participants with tinnitus interfering with daily life reported more depressive (difference, 0.20; 95% CI, 0.11-0.28) and anxiety (difference, 0.15; 95% CI, 0.08-0.22) symptoms and poorer sleep quality (difference, 0.10; 95% CI, 0.03-0.16). Compared with participants without tinnitus, participants with nonbothersome tinnitus also reported more depressive (difference, 0.06; 95% CI, 0.03-0.09) and anxiety (difference, 0.05; 95% CI, 0.02-0.07) symptoms and poorer sleep quality (difference, 0.05; 95% CI, 0.03-0.08). Individuals indicating more interference with daily life reported having more mental health problems. During a mean follow-up of 4.4 years (range, 3.5-5.1 years), participants with tinnitus reported more anxiety symptoms and poorer sleep quality than those without tinnitus. Conclusions and Relevance Findings of this population-based cohort study indicate that tinnitus was associated with more mental health problems in middle-aged and elderly persons in the general population, in particular when tinnitus interfered with daily life but not solely. Over time, more severe tinnitus was associated with an increase in anxiety symptoms and poor sleep quality. This outcome suggests that mental health problems may be part of the burden of tinnitus, even among individuals who do not report their tinnitus interfering with daily life.

Rucker B, Umbarger E, Ottwell R, Arthur W, Brame L, Woodson E, Wright DN, Hartwell M, Khojasteh J, Vassar M. Evaluation of Spin in the Abstracts of Systematic Reviews and Meta-Analyses Focused on Tinnitus. Otol Neurotol 2021; 42:1237-1244. [PMID: 33973954 DOI: 10.1097/mao.0000000000003178]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/16/2022]
Abstract
HYPOTHESIS The objective was to investigate the prevalence of spin in abstracts of systematic reviews and meta-analyses covering the treatment of tinnitus. We hypothesized that spin would be present in these articles and a significant relationship would exist between spin usage and extracted study characteristics. BACKGROUND Spin, the misrepresentation of study findings, can alter a clinician's interpretation of a study's results, potentially affecting patient care. Previous work demonstrates that spin is present in abstracts of randomized clinical trials. METHODS Using a cross-sectional analysis, we conducted a systematic search using MEDLINE and Embase databases on June 2, 2020, for systematic reviews focused on tinnitus treatment. Investigators performed screening and data extraction in a masked, duplicate fashion. RESULTS Forty systematic reviews met inclusion criteria, and spin was identified in four of them. Spin in abstracts most frequently occurred when conclusions claimed the beneficial effect of the experimental treatment despite high risk of bias in primary studies (n = 3). The other form of spin found was the conclusion claims safety based on nonstatistically significant results with a wide confidence interval (n = 1). There was no significant association between spin and any of our extracted study characteristics. CONCLUSION Spin was observed in 10% of abstracts of systematic reviews and meta-analyses covering the treatment of tinnitus. Although this percentage may be small, we recommend that medical journals provide a more detailed framework for abstract structure and require the inclusion of risk of bias assessment results in abstracts to prevent the incorporation of spin.

McKenna L, Vogt F, Marks E. Current Validated Medical Treatments for Tinnitus: Cognitive Behavioral Therapy. Otolaryngol Clin North Am 2020; 53:605-615. [PMID: 32334871 DOI: 10.1016/j.otc.2020.03.007] [Citation(s) in RCA: 10]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/25/2022]
Abstract
Tinnitus distress results from a weave of physical and psychological processes. Reducing the power of the psychological processes will therefore reduce the degree of suffering. The main psychological therapy in this context is cognitive behavioral therapy (CBT). This seeks to understand and change the influence of thinking processes, including information processing biases, and the behaviors that these motivate, on the experience of tinnitus. The results of systematic reviews and meta-analyses indicate that CBT is the tinnitus management approach for which there is the most robust evidence. In spite of this, it remains difficult to access for people with tinnitus.

Marks E, Smith P, McKenna L. I Wasn't at War With the Noise: How Mindfulness Based Cognitive Therapy Changes Patients' Experiences of Tinnitus. Front Psychol 2020; 11:483. [PMID: 32362850 PMCID: PMC7182032 DOI: 10.3389/fpsyg.2020.00483]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/13/2019] [Accepted: 03/02/2020] [Indexed: 12/18/2022] Open
Abstract
OBJECTIVES Intrusive tinnitus is a challenging, life-changing experience for which traditional medical treatment does not yet have a cure. However, Mindfulness Based Cognitive Therapy for tinnitus (MBCT-t) is effective in reducing tinnitus-related distress, disability and intrusiveness. It is a priority to understand patients' experience of MBCT-t and active processes which they regarded as underpinning the changes they experienced. Semi-structured interviews were conducted 6 months after participants had completed MBCT as part of a randomized controlled trial (RCT), with a focus on exploring their experiences of the course, what they felt had changed and how they felt such changes had occurred. METHODS Nine participants took part and Interpretative Phenomenological Analysis (IPA) was used to analyze the interview transcripts. RESULTS Four overarching themes emerged: (1) Relating to Tinnitus in a New Way, (2) Holistic Benefits, (3) Connection, Kindness and Compassion, and (4) Factors Supporting Engagement and Change. CONCLUSION All participants reported benefits from MBCT-t, based on a radically new relationship with tinnitus. It was no longer characterized by "fighting it" and was instead based on "allowing" tinnitus to be present. Changes were supported by the development of open, stable, present-moment awareness and attitudes of equanimity, kindness, and compassion. Practices encouraging focus on sound (including tinnitus) were challenging, but essential to learning this new way of being with tinnitus. MBCT-t had a huge range of benefits including reduced distress and enhanced wellbeing. The group nature of MBCT-t was an integral part of the therapeutic process. A number of clinical and research implications are discussed.

Fuller T, Cima R, Langguth B, Mazurek B, Vlaeyen JWS, Hoare DJ. Cognitive behavioural therapy for tinnitus. Cochrane Database Syst Rev 2020; 1:CD012614. [PMID: 31912887 PMCID: PMC6956618 DOI: 10.1002/14651858.cd012614.pub2] [Citation(s) in RCA: 66] [Impact Index Per Article: 16.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/29/2022]
Abstract
BACKGROUND Tinnitus affects up to 21% of the adult population with an estimated 1% to 3% experiencing severe problems. Cognitive behavioural therapy (CBT) is a collection of psychological treatments based on the cognitive and behavioural traditions in psychology and often used to treat people suffering from tinnitus. OBJECTIVES To assess the effects and safety of CBT for tinnitus in adults. SEARCH METHODS The Cochrane ENT Information Specialist searched the ENT Trials Register; CENTRAL (2019, Issue 11); Ovid MEDLINE; Ovid Embase; CINAHL; Web of Science; ClinicalTrials.gov; ICTRP and additional sources for published and unpublished trials. The date of the search was 25 November 2019. SELECTION CRITERIA Randomised controlled trials (RCTs) of CBT versus no intervention, audiological care, tinnitus retraining therapy or any other active treatment in adult participants with tinnitus. DATA COLLECTION AND ANALYSIS We used the standard methodological procedures expected by Cochrane. Our primary outcomes were the impact of tinnitus on disease-specific quality of life and serious adverse effects. Our secondary outcomes were: depression, anxiety, general health-related quality of life, negatively biased interpretations of tinnitus and other adverse effects. We used GRADE to assess the certainty of evidence for each outcome. MAIN RESULTS We included 28 studies (mostly from Europe) with a total of 2733 participants. All participants had had tinnitus for at least three months and their average age ranged from 43 to 70 years. The duration of the CBT ranged from 3 to 22 weeks and it was mostly conducted in hospitals or online. There were four comparisons and we were interested in outcomes at end of treatment, and 6 and 12 months follow-up. The results below only refer to outcomes at end of treatment due to an absence of evidence at the other follow-up time points. CBT versus no intervention/wait list control Fourteen studies compared CBT with no intervention/wait list control. For the primary outcome, CBT may reduce the impact of tinnitus on quality of life at treatment end (standardised mean difference (SMD) -0.56, 95% confidence interval (CI) -0.83 to -0.30; 10 studies; 537 participants; low certainty). Re-expressed as a score on the Tinnitus Handicap Inventory (THI; range 0 to 100) this is equivalent to a score 10.91 points lower in the CBT group, with an estimated minimal clinically important difference (MCID) for this scale being 7 points. Seven studies, rated as moderate certainty, either reported or informed us via personal communication about serious adverse effects. CBT probably results in little or no difference in adverse effects: six studies reported none and in one study one participant in the CBT condition worsened (risk ratio (RR) 3.00, 95% CI 0.13 to 69.87). For the secondary outcomes, CBT may result in a slight reduction in depression (SMD -0.34, 95% CI-0.60 to -0.08; 8 studies; 502 participants; low certainty). However, we are uncertain whether CBT reduces anxiety, improves health-related quality of life or reduces negatively biased interpretations of tinnitus (all very low certainty). From seven studies, no other adverse effects were reported (moderate certainty). CBT versus audiological care Three studies compared CBT with audiological care. CBT probably reduces the impact of tinnitus on quality of life when compared with audiological care as measured by the THI (range 0 to 100; mean difference (MD) -5.65, 95% CI -9.79 to -1.50; 3 studies; 444 participants) (moderate certainty; MCID = 7 points). No serious adverse effects occurred in the two included studies reporting these, thus risk ratios were not calculated (moderate certainty). The evidence suggests that CBT may slightly reduce depression but may result in little or no difference in anxiety or health-related quality of life (all low certainty) when compared with audiological care. CBT may reduce negatively biased interpretations of tinnitus when compared with audiological care (low certainty). No other adverse effects were reported for either group (moderate certainty). CBT versus tinnitus retraining therapy (TRT) One study compared CBT with TRT (including bilateral sound generators as per TRT protocol). CBT may reduce the impact of tinnitus on quality of life as measured by the THI when compared with TRT (range 0 to 100) (MD -15.79, 95% CI -27.91 to -3.67; 1 study; 42 participants; low certainty). For serious adverse effects three participants deteriorated during the study: one in the CBT (n = 22) and two in the TRT group (n = 20) (RR 0.45, 95% CI 0.04 to 4.64; low certainty). We are uncertain whether CBT reduces depression and anxiety or improves health-related quality of life (low certainty). CBT may reduce negatively biased interpretations of tinnitus. No data were available for other adverse effects. CBT versus other active control Sixteen studies compared CBT with another active control (e.g. relaxation, information, Internet-based discussion forums). CBT may reduce the impact of tinnitus on quality of life when compared with other active treatments (SMD -0.30, 95% CI -0.55 to -0.05; 12 studies; 966 participants; low certainty). Re-expressed as a THI score this is equivalent to 5.84 points lower in the CBT group than the other active control group (MCID = 7 points). One study reported that three participants deteriorated: one in the CBT and two in the information only group (RR 1.70, 95% CI 0.16 to 18.36; low certainty). CBT may reduce depression and anxiety (both low certainty). We are uncertain whether CBT improves health-related quality of life compared with other control. CBT probably reduces negatively biased interpretations of tinnitus compared with other treatments. No data were available for other adverse effects. AUTHORS' CONCLUSIONS CBT may be effective in reducing the negative impact that tinnitus can have on quality of life. There is, however, an absence of evidence at 6 or 12 months follow-up. There is also some evidence that adverse effects may be rare in adults with tinnitus receiving CBT, but this could be further investigated. CBT for tinnitus may have small additional benefit in reducing symptoms of depression although uncertainty remains due to concerns about the quality of the evidence. Overall, there is limited evidence for CBT for tinnitus improving anxiety, health-related quality of life or negatively biased interpretations of tinnitus.
